From the New York Post:
 
 PHIL HAS BAD-HAIR DAY
 
 May 24, 2005 -- Call him Phil Spectacle. Looking like a cross between a hippie and a Brillo pad, Phil Spector sat glumly yesterday as a Los Angeles judge ruled that four women who claim the legendary record producer pulled a gun on them can testify at his murder trial.  
 
 All eyes were on Spector's hedge of wiry blond hair as Deputy District Attorney Doug Sortino argued that the music guru used guns to threaten or intimidate women in "an ongoing course of conduct that happens again and again and again."
